-%define elfutils_ver 0.168
+%define elfutils_ver 0.178
%define elfutils_dir %{_builddir}/elfutils
Name: libabigail
Version: 1.7
Release: 0
Source0: %name-%version.src.tar.gz
-Source1: elfutils-%{elfutils_ver}.tar.xz
+Source1: elfutils-%{elfutils_ver}.tar.bz2
Url: https://www.sourceware.org/libabigail/
ExclusiveArch: x86_64
%reconfigure \
--program-prefix=eu- \
--enable-maintainer-mode \
- --disable-dependency-tracking
+ --disable-dependency-tracking \
+ --disable-debuginfod
%{__make} %{?_smp_flags} V=1
%{__make} DESTDIR=%{elfutils_dir} install
# Add path to elfutils static ibraries
export CPPFLAGS="-I%{elfutils_dir}%{_includedir}"
export LDFLAGS="-L%{elfutils_dir}%{_libdir} -Wl,--as-needed"
-export LIBS="-ldw -lelf -lebl -ldl -lbz2 -lz -llzma"
+export LIBS="-pthread -ldw -lelf -ldl -lbz2 -lz -llzma"
%reconfigure \
--disable-shared \
+ --enable-static \
--disable-dependency-tracking \
--enable-rpm=yes \
--enable-deb=no \